Guest guest Posted November 3, 2004 Report Share Posted November 3, 2004 Jennipher, You don't have to have the heel touching the bottom of the shoe. You just need to make sure that the heel is in the window. Of coarse you want it to be as close to the bottom of the shoe as possible but it isn't neccessary for it to touch the bottom.
